ELK beats yum和命令行工具(13th)
<p>这篇是配置yum源和beat命令行。</p><h3>为yum添加beats库</h3>
<p>下载并安装公共签名证书:</p><pre class="brush:bash;toolbar:false"># rpm --import https://packages.elastic.co/GPG-KEY-elasticsearch</pre><p>添加repo文件:</p><pre class="brush:bash;toolbar:false"># vim /etc/yum.repo.d/beats.repo
name=Elastic Beats Repository
baseurl=https://packages.elastic.co/beats/yum/el/$basearch
enabled=1
gpgkey=https://packages.elastic.co/GPG-KEY-elasticsearch
gpgcheck=1</pre><p>安装Filebeat、Packetbeat、Topbeat:</p><pre class="brush:bash;toolbar:false"># yum install filebeat
# yum install packetbeat
# yum install topbeat</pre><p>这三个beat下文每个介绍过去。</p>
<h3>命令行工具</h3>
<p>下面的命令行选项可用于所有的beat。当然啦,每个beat也可以有自己的独特的选项,这个看各自的文档。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-N</code></strong></span></span></p>
<p>禁止将事件发送到已定义的输出。该选项主要用于测试beat。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-c <file></code></strong></span></span></p>
<p>指定beat配置文件。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-cpuprofile <output file></code></strong></span></span></p>
<p>将CPU profile 数据写入到指定文件。该选项主要用于beat排错。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-d <selectors></code></strong></span></span></p>
<p>为指定的selectors启用debug。对于selectors 可以指定用逗号分隔的列表组件,也可以使用-d "*" 启用debug所有组件。例如 <code class="literal">-d "publish"</code> 显示所有 "publish" 有关的消息。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-e</code></strong></span></span></p>
<p>记录到stderr,和禁用系统日志或文件输出。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-memprofile <output file></code></strong></span></span></p>
<p>将 memory profile 数据写入到指定文件。该选项主要用于beat排错。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-configtest</code></strong></span></span></p>
<p>测试配置文件是否正确。该选项主要用于beat配置排错。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-v</code></strong></span></span></p>
<p>输出INFO级别相信信息。</p>
<p><span class="term"><span class="strong"><strong><code class="literal">-version</code></strong></span></span></p>
<p>显示beat版本信息。</p>
頁:
[1]